Output 1eb767e6ad2d901790cafcf328846b24c5a82b8b73e585a98f53107159795222:1

value
109064
script pubkey
OP_0 OP_PUSHBYTES_20 d68d0346160c8a41d86dc368fe3d9cd648e39e7e
address
bc1q66xsx3skpj9yrkrdcd50u0vu6eyw88n73swkex
transaction
1eb767e6ad2d901790cafcf328846b24c5a82b8b73e585a98f53107159795222
confirmations
174720
spent
true